Participatie, het verschil tussen een methode en een kritisch paradigma
摘要
Policy makers and funding agencies increasingly expect citizens to be actively involved in research, policy development and intervention design. This growing popularity requires us to stay sharp on the conceptualization of participation; do we (still) mean and intend the same thing when we talk about participation? Drawing on literature and many years of practical experience, we show that the meaning of participation has shifted over the years from a critical paradigm, centering on empowerment and critical questioning of power, to a search for methods to give vulnerable people a voice within existing structures. In this article, we argue why it is important to re-connect with the original critical paradigm.
